
更多请点击 https://codechina.net第一章软考高项案例分析命题逻辑与评分标准全景透视软考高级信息系统项目管理师高项案例分析题并非知识堆砌的测试而是对项目管理实战能力、结构化表达与问题诊断思维的综合检验。命题者严格依据《信息系统项目管理师考试大纲2023年修订版》中“案例分析”能力域要求聚焦十大知识领域在真实场景中的冲突、权衡与决策过程尤其偏爱考查范围蔓延、进度压缩失当、干系人沟通失效、变更控制失序等高频痛点。 评分标准采用“采分点逻辑链”双维模型每道题预设5–8个核心采分点如“识别出需求基线未冻结即启动开发”每个采分点需同时满足“准确识别问题”“引用PMBOK/国标术语”“提出可落地改进措施”三项要素方可得分缺失任一要素则该点不得分。典型失分情形包括仅罗列理论未结合案例背景、措施空泛如“加强沟通”未说明对象/方式/频次、混淆过程组与知识领域边界。 以下为近年高频命题模式对照表命题主题典型题干特征隐含考察重点范围管理客户频繁提出新增功能项目经理口头承诺后补流程需求跟踪矩阵缺失、变更控制流程未执行、WBS分解颗粒度失控进度管理关键路径任务延误7天项目经理强制赶工致质量缺陷进度压缩方法误用赶工vs快速跟进、风险储备未启用、挣值分析缺失考生需建立“问题定位→理论映射→措施具象化”三步应答范式。例如针对范围蔓延问题须按如下逻辑展开定位指出“未经CCB审批即实施需求变更”违反变更控制流程GB/T 42714-2023第6.4条映射关联PMBOK第4章“整体变更控制”与第5章“收集需求”过程组输入输出关系具象化提出“立即冻结当前版本启动变更请求登记→影响分析→CCB评审→更新范围基准”闭环动作# 示例考生作答中常见错误代码片段非程序代码指逻辑断层 【错误】“应该加强范围管理。” 【正解】“应立即暂停新增功能开发由PMO组织CCB召开紧急会议依据变更日志评估对成本/进度/质量的影响参考PMBOK图4.6批准后同步更新WBS词典与需求跟踪矩阵并向干系人发布变更通知单。”第二章项目整体管理高频考点精讲2.1 项目章程编制的理论框架与真题实战拆解核心要素映射模型项目章程本质是组织战略与执行层的契约载体需精准锚定目标、干系人、边界与授权层级。以下为关键字段与PMBOK®第七版要素对照表章程字段理论依据真题高频考点项目目的商业论证需求文件常与“未获批准的变更请求”混淆成功标准协议条款效益管理计划易被误认为仅含进度/成本指标自动化章程校验逻辑# 基于JSON Schema校验章程完整性 schema { required: [project_name, sponsor, approval_authority], properties: { approval_authority: {type: string, minLength: 3} } }该逻辑强制校验发起人、授权主体等不可省略字段minLength: 3防止占位符如“N/A”通过校验确保责任主体可追溯。干系人权力-影响矩阵应用高权力高影响者章程须经其签字确认如CIO低权力高影响者纳入沟通策略附件但不参与审批2.2 项目管理计划制定的关键要素与常见失分点反推核心要素三角校验范围、进度、成本三者必须动态联动校验。任意一项变更需触发其余两项的再评估否则将引发基线漂移。常见失分点反推表失分现象反推根源修复动作里程碑频繁延期WBS未分解至可验证交付物强制每个工作包绑定验收标准与责任人干系人投诉信息不同步沟通管理计划缺失频率/渠道/升级路径定义RACI矩阵并嵌入协作平台自动化触发风险登记册初始化示例# risk-register.yaml - id: RISK-001 title: 第三方API响应延迟超阈值 probability: 0.35 # 基于历史调用数据拟合 impact: HIGH # 影响关键路径上3个活动 response: 预置降级接口熔断阈值设为800ms该YAML结构强制要求每个风险项必须包含可量化的概率0.0–1.0与影响等级LOW/MEDIUM/HIGH避免模糊描述。2.3 整体变更控制流程的标准化建模与案例秒杀路径标准化建模四要素变更控制流程需固化为可执行模型包含触发条件、审批角色链、影响评估矩阵、回滚契约。以下为关键状态机定义// 状态跃迁校验逻辑 func ValidateTransition(from, to string) bool { validTransitions : map[string][]string{ Draft: {Review, Rejected}, Review: {Approved, Revised, Rejected}, Approved: {Deploying, Cancelled}, Deploying: {Deployed, RolledBack}, } for _, next : range validTransitions[from] { if next to { return true } } return false }该函数确保变更仅沿预设路径流转from为当前状态to为目标状态避免跳变或循环。秒杀场景下的轻量级适配针对高并发发布场景采用分级熔断策略一级变更请求自动限流QPS ≤ 5二级影响范围超10服务实例时强制人工复核三级核心链路变更需双签灰度验证报告审批时效性对比表变更类型标准流程耗时秒杀路径耗时配置类4小时≤90秒代码热更2工作日≤5分钟2.4 项目监控与收尾阶段的文档链验证技巧文档溯源校验脚本# 验证交付物哈希链完整性 sha256sum -c docs.sha256 2/dev/null | grep -v : OK$该脚本比对当前文档集与签名清单中记录的 SHA256 值仅输出校验失败项。docs.sha256 由收尾阶段生成并经 PMO 签名确保每份文档在归档后未被篡改。关键交付物状态矩阵文档类型签署方时效阈值验证方式验收报告客户QA≤72h数字签名时间戳服务运维手册运维团队≤24hGit commit hash 关联自动化验证流程扫描所有 PDF/DOCX 文件的元数据嵌入签名字段调用 CA 接口验证证书链有效性比对 Jira 工单闭环时间与文档签署时间戳2.5 组织过程资产与事业环境因素的动态识别与应用在项目执行过程中组织过程资产OPA与事业环境因素EEF并非静态参考库而是需实时感知、分类评估并注入决策流的动态数据源。动态识别信号捕获通过CI/CD流水线日志自动提取流程模板变更事件监听HR系统接口获取关键岗位人员变动如PMO负责人变更订阅云平台API获取区域合规策略更新如GDPR新条款生效资产-环境映射表识别源资产/因素类型影响维度触发动作Confluence APIOPA历史复盘文档风险应对策略自动关联当前风险登记册AWS ConfigEEF云服务区域限制部署架构阻断跨区域镜像推送运行时注入示例// 根据动态EEF调整资源申请策略 func adjustResourcePlan(eef EEFContext) *ResourcePlan { if eef.Region CN-NORTH-1 { return ResourcePlan{CPU: 8c, Memory: 32G, StorageClass: gp3} // 合规限定存储类型 } return ResourcePlan{CPU: 16c, Memory: 64G, StorageClass: io2} // 默认高IO配置 }该函数依据实时获取的EEF上下文如地域合规约束动态生成基础设施资源方案避免硬编码导致的合规风险。参数eef.Region来自云端策略同步服务确保每次部署前完成环境因子校验。第三章范围与进度管理核心突破3.1 WBS分解原则与真实项目场景下的层级校验法核心分解原则WBS必须满足“100%规则”下层工作包之和严格等于上层交付物范围不可遗漏或重叠。同时遵循“可交付导向”——每个节点必须产出可验收、可测量的成果。层级校验四步法交付物反推从最终用户验收标准逐级拆解责任映射每个工作包绑定唯一RACI角色粒度验证检查任意节点是否满足“2周内可完成独立测试”依赖扫描用有向图识别跨层级硬依赖典型校验代码片段# 校验WBS节点是否满足100%覆盖 def validate_wbs_coverage(node): if node.is_leaf(): return True child_sum sum(c.estimated_hours for c in node.children) return abs(child_sum - node.estimated_hours) 0.5 # 允许0.5人时误差该函数以人时为统一计量单位对非叶节点执行子项工时累加校验阈值0.5人时容忍估算偏差避免因四舍五入导致误判。校验结果对照表层级深度平均节点数校验通过率常见缺陷L1系统级5100%无L3模块级2286%边界交叉、验收标准模糊3.2 关键路径法CPM与浮动时间计算的陷阱规避策略常见浮动时间误算根源忽略活动依赖方向FS/SS/FF导致总浮动TF与自由浮动FF混淆未区分正向与反向推导中时差累积效应引发关键路径漂移浮动时间安全校验代码# 输入活动ID, ES, EF, LS, LF def validate_floats(activity): tf activity[LS] - activity[ES] # 总浮动 ff min([next_es - activity[EF] for next_es in activity.get(successor_ES, [float(inf)])]) - 0 assert tf ff 0, f浮动矛盾TF{tf}, FF{ff} for {activity[id]} return {TF: tf, FF: max(0, ff)}逻辑说明该函数强制校验TF ≥ FF ≥ 0约束参数successor_ES为所有紧后活动最早开始时间集合确保自由浮动基于实际依赖链计算。典型场景对比表场景错误做法正确处理虚活动参与路径忽略虚活动持续时间为0的影响将虚活动纳入ES/EF/LF反推链保持逻辑完整性多起点/终点统一设ES0/LFproject_end引入虚拟源汇节点保障网络连通性3.3 范围蔓延识别与需求跟踪矩阵的双向验证实践需求跟踪矩阵RTM结构设计需求ID来源测试用例ID状态变更记录REQ-082用户访谈V2TC-082-A, TC-082-B已验证2024-05-11新增REQ-107bPR#44非计划提交—待评估2024-06-03未关联自动化范围偏离检测脚本def detect_scope_creep(rtms: list[dict]) - list[str]: 识别未关联测试用例或无变更审批的需求项 creep_candidates [] for req in rtms: if not req.get(test_case_ids) and PR# in req.get(source, ): if not req.get(approval_id): # 缺少审批标识 creep_candidates.append(req[id]) return creep_candidates该函数扫描RTM中来源含“PR#”但未绑定测试用例且缺失approval_id字段的需求精准定位未经评审即进入开发的范围蔓延点。双向验证执行流程前向验证从需求ID → 追溯至设计文档、代码提交、测试用例后向验证从测试失败用例 → 反查对应需求是否被裁剪或变更未同步第四章成本、质量与风险管理实战攻坚4.1 挣值分析EVM三参数联动计算与偏差归因速判法核心三参数定义与实时联动关系EV挣值、PV计划值、AC实际成本构成EVM的黄金三角其动态比值直接映射项目健康度指标公式健康阈值CPIEV / AC1.0 表示成本节约SPIEV / PV0.95 预示进度风险偏差归因速判逻辑树若 CPI 1 且 SPI 1 → 成本超支 进度滞后双重挤压若 CPI 1 但 SPI 1 → “烧钱抢工”需审查资源冗余Python 辅助速算脚本def evm_diagnose(ev, pv, ac): cpi ev / ac if ac else 0 spi ev / pv if pv else 0 # 归因规则引擎 if cpi 0.95 and spi 0.95: return 双偏差立即启动根因分析 return fCPI{cpi:.2f}, SPI{spi:.2f}该函数将三参数输入转化为结构化诊断结论cpi与spi分母防零处理确保鲁棒性返回字符串直指归因路径。4.2 质量审计与过程改进的PDCA闭环设计模板PDCA四阶段标准化接口通过定义统一的事件钩子实现Plan-Do-Check-Act各阶段可插拔集成// PDCAStage 定义各阶段执行契约 type PDCAStage interface { Execute(ctx context.Context, audit *QualityAudit) error Validate() error // 输入校验 }该接口确保每个阶段具备独立验证能力与上下文感知性audit 结构体携带过程指标、基线阈值及审计元数据。闭环驱动状态机阶段触发条件输出物Plan周期性审计任务生成改进项清单含优先级Check自动化度量采集完成偏差报告Δ≥5%自动告警改进策略落地路径审计发现→映射至CMMI过程域ID改进项→绑定Jira Epic与CI/CD流水线标签效果验证→对比前/后SLO达标率变化4.3 风险识别技术SWOT/鱼骨图在案例中的结构化输出技巧SWOT矩阵的结构化填充规范在实际项目复盘中需将抽象维度转化为可验证条目。例如技术劣势W不应写“系统性能差”而应明确为“API平均响应延迟超800msP95”。鱼骨图根因标注实践使用标准化标签提升追溯性# 鱼骨图分支节点元数据定义 { category: Manpower, # 人、机、料、法、环、测六类之一 root_cause: CI/CD流水线未配置并发限流, evidence: [构建失败率12.7%, Jenkins队列平均等待210s], owner: DevOps组 }该结构确保每个分支具备可归责性与度量锚点避免归因模糊。双模型交叉验证表SWOT象限对应鱼骨图分支验证方式外部威胁TEnvironment第三方服务SLA波动日志分析内部优势SMethod自动化测试覆盖率≥85%审计报告4.4 应急储备与管理储备的判定逻辑与预算分配实操核心判定维度应急储备应对已识别风险管理储备覆盖未知—未知风险。关键判据包括风险可追溯性、触发条件明确性、是否纳入风险登记册。预算分配逻辑应急储备按风险概率×影响值加权汇总单项目上限通常为基线成本的5%–10%管理储备由发起人控制一般设为总预算的3%–8%不计入绩效测量基准BAC动态分配示例阶段应急储备万元管理储备万元需求分析128开发实施2815# 储备释放阈值计算逻辑 def calc_reserve_release(probability, impact, threshold0.6): # probability: 风险发生概率0–1 # impact: 财务影响万元 # threshold: 预设触发阈值如60%置信度 return impact * probability if probability threshold else 0该函数仅在风险发生概率≥60%时激活应急储备释放避免过早消耗参数impact需来自定量风险分析结果确保财务影响可追溯至WBS工作包。第五章软考高项案例分析能力跃迁的底层认知重构传统备考常将案例题视为“模板套用”训练而高分突破的关键在于对项目管理知识域的动态建模能力。某省级政务云迁移项目中考生面对“进度延误范围蔓延干系人冲突”三重叠加问题仅套用“变更控制流程”模板得3分但重构为“基于价值流的优先级再平衡模型”后获14分——其核心是将PMBOK过程组转化为可计算的约束关系。从线性流程到系统反馈回路识别关键反馈环如“需求确认延迟→测试周期压缩→缺陷率上升→返工耗时增加→进度进一步滞后”在答题中显式标注反馈增益如“该环节放大误差系数达1.8”结构化拆解技术债务影响技术决策短期收益长期成本案例中量化值跳过UAT直接上线节省5人日生产环境缺陷修复耗时27人日ROI -5.4多维约束建模示例# 基于真实阅卷标准构建的评分权重函数 def case_score(analysis_depth, constraint_mapping, stakeholder_model): # analysis_depth: 深度维度0-5分含因果链长度与反事实推演 # constraint_mapping: 范围/进度/成本三维耦合度0-3分 # stakeholder_model: 干系人权力-利益矩阵动态演化建模0-2分 return min(20, int(analysis_depth * 4 constraint_mapping * 5 stakeholder_model * 3))认知重构的实操锚点每次练习强制标注“未被显性化的隐性约束”如组织文化容忍度、历史项目负债用不同颜色荧光笔标记答案中的“假设前提”“边界条件”“失效阈值”